Nike Air Zoom Flight 95 Pack
Release Date: May 31
Release Price: $160 USD, available on SNKRS app, Nike.com, Nike retailers and select retailers like Titolo
The “Bug Eyes” return in a trio of colorways for fans of old school ’90s basketball silhouettes. “Back from ‘95” black, “‘95 Neutral,” and “Pearl Pink” arrive right before the calendar flips to June.
Nike LeBron Solider 11 “Prototype”
Release Date: May 31
Release Price: $140 USD, available on SNKRS app, Nike.com and Nike retailers
The newest silhouette in the LeBron Soldier series recognizes last year’s Finals achievement while looking forward to this year’s quest for a repeat. A clean black colorway with an icy sole is ice cold like LBJ and the Cavs.

adidas UltraBOOST 3.0 “Bronze BOOST”
Release Date: May 31
Release Price: $180 USD, available at select adidas retailers like Afew
Donning a bronze BOOST sole, this iteration of the popular UltraBOOST silhouette is perfect for making a statement while still staying minimalist. The bronze lace tips add to the detailing and flair of the sneaker while contrasting the black perfectly.
adidas Originals YEEZY Powerphase
Release Date: May 31 Confirmed app reservations open, June 4 store pickups
Release Price: $120 USD, available on Confirmed app and select adidas Originals locations
Kanye’s highly sought after YEEZY Powerphase will finally make its way to adidas Originals locations via the Confirmed app. Fans will need to have quick trigger fingers if they want to pick up this Calabasas piece.
Carhartt WIP x Converse Chuck Taylor All Star ’70s Pack
Release Date: June 1
Release Price: N/A, available on Carhartt WIP’s web store and Converse.com
Carhartt WIP teams up with Converse for some work ready summer Chucks. Brown, white and tiger camo makes an appearance on the classic All Star ’70s for a look that’s timeless.
Nike Cortez Pack
Release Date: June 1
Release Price: $75 USD (“Compton” and “Long Beach”), $80 USD (“OG” and “Oregon”), available on SNKRS app, Nike.com and Nike retailers
Celebrating 45 years of heritage, the Nike Cortez silhouette comes back in force. The OG red, white and blue colorway returns, a green/yellow colorway pays homage to Oregon, and a blue “Long Beach” and black “Compton” pair pay tribute to the history of the Cortez in Cali.

Nike KD 10 “Still KD”
Release Date: June 1 (During the NBA Finals)
Release Price: $150 USD, available on SNKRS app whenever Kevin Durant is playing in Game 1
KD’s tenth signature sneaker with Nike will get a special release method during this year’s NBA Finals. Every time KD is on the court playing, fans will be able to purchase the “Still KDs” on SNKRS app and be automatically entered to win 1 of 10 exclusive signed boxes.

adidas UltraBOOST 3.0 “Pride/LGBTQ”
Release Date: June 1
Release Price: $180 USD, available at select adidas retailers
Before Nike delivers its Pride Pack, adidas will drop off an UltraBOOST 3.0 of its own for Pride Month. The rainbow flag makes its way onto the heel counter for a defined look celebrating all walks of life.
Nike Cortez Jewel Pack
Release Date: June 3
Release Price: $100 USD, available on SNKRS app, Nike.com and select Nike retailers
Continuing the celebration of its 45th anniversary, Nike gives the Cortez a Jewel makeover. The jewel motif in “Rare Ruby” and “Black Diamond” will also be seen on the Air Max 1 a few days later.
